  • Abstract
    Lattice algorithm has been employed in numerous adaptive filtering applications such as speech analysis/synthesis, noise cancelling, spectral analysis, channel equalization. In this paper we are concerned with the application to adaptive arrays processing. The advantages are fast convergent rate as well as computational accuracy independent of the noise and interference conditions. The results produced by this technique will be compared to those obtained by the direct matrix inverse method.
